Usually I type cmd in the address bar on the top of Windows Explorer where the .exe is located, which will open up cmd with the proper mount and type program.exe -h or -help to print out a list, they usually do this.
For example, something like this
Command prompt isn't actually all that hard to use, any decent mod creator usually embeds their exe with a help command that prints text of available commands.
